Skip to content

feat: allow users to provide an existing self-signed certificate#17

Merged
reubenmiller merged 1 commit intomainfrom
feat-create-thing-with-existing-cert
Apr 23, 2025
Merged

feat: allow users to provide an existing self-signed certificate#17
reubenmiller merged 1 commit intomainfrom
feat-create-thing-with-existing-cert

Conversation

@reubenmiller
Copy link
Copy Markdown
Contributor

Allow users to provide an existing certificate that should be used for the device to support use-cases such as interacting with a PKCS11 module

@github-actions
Copy link
Copy Markdown

github-actions Bot commented Apr 23, 2025

Robot Results

✅ Passed ❌ Failed ⏭️ Skipped Total Pass % ⏱️ Duration
26 0 0 26 100 13.041389s

Passed Tests

Name ⏱️ Duration Suite
Get IoT Url 0.599 s Account
Get Account ID 0.330 s Account
Create certificate key pair 0.507 s Certificates
Create CSR using AWS CA 0.473 s Certificates
Upload self-signed certificate 0.369 s Certificates
Create Certificate and Thing 0.679 s Composite
Start/stop MQTT logger 0.619 s Logger
Assert message count 2.770 s Logger
Assert MQTT message 2.700 s Logger
Create a new Policy 0.177 s Policies
Deleting a non-existent Policy should not throw an error 0.082 s Policies
Deleting a non-existent Policy should throw an error 0.079 s Policies
Assert that a policy exists 0.168 s Policies
Fails if policy does not exist 0.080 s Policies
Create Thing with auto cleanup 0.158 s Thing
Create Thing with Principal 0.592 s Thing
Delete Thing 0.244 s Thing
Delete non-existent thing 0.078 s Thing
Check if thing exists 0.078 s Thing
Throws an error if thing exists 2.252 s Thing
Get Local Command Topic 0.001 s Topics
Get Cloud Command Topic 0.001 s Topics
Get Telemetry Topic 0.001 s Topics
Get Registration Topic 0.001 s Topics
Get cloud topic for the AWS shadow 0.001 s Topics
Get local topic for the AWS shadow 0.001 s Topics

@reubenmiller reubenmiller merged commit 8f5ce00 into main Apr 23, 2025
15 checks passed
@reubenmiller reubenmiller deleted the feat-create-thing-with-existing-cert branch April 23, 2025 14:40
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ant